Single Jersey vs. Cotton Jersey Fabric

Single Jersey vs. Cotton Jersey Fabric: What’s the Difference?

Understand the difference between fabric construction and fiber content to choose the right jersey fabric for your garments.

Single and cotton jersey fabrics


What is Single Jersey Fabric?

Single jersey is a type of knit fabric made using one set of needles. It features a smooth surface on the front and looped or textured surface on the back. It is commonly used in lightweight garments like t-shirts and dresses.

  • Lightweight and breathable
  • Stretchy widthwise
  • Economical and easy to produce
  • Tends to curl at the edges when cut

What is Cotton Jersey Fabric?

Cotton jersey is jersey knit fabric made from cotton fibers. It can be single or double jersey in construction. The key characteristic is the use of natural, breathable, and skin-friendly cotton.

  • Soft and gentle on the skin
  • Breathable and moisture-absorbent
  • Ideal for t-shirts, babywear, underwear

Key Differences at a Glance

Feature Single Jersey Cotton Jersey
Type Knit structure Fiber content
Texture Smooth front, looped back Uniformly soft and smooth
Material Can be cotton, viscose, polyester, etc. 100% cotton or cotton blend
Stretch Stretchy in one direction Depends on blend and knit
Usage T-shirts, dresses, casual wear Babywear, undergarments, casual wear

Can You Have Cotton Single Jersey?

Yes! Cotton single jersey is a common and popular fabric used for everyday t-shirts and casual clothing. It combines the lightweight, stretchy structure of single jersey with the breathability and softness of cotton.

Whether you’re buying fabrics or designing your own garments, understanding the difference between single jersey and cotton jersey can help you make the right choice. One refers to how the fabric is made, and the other refers to what it’s made from. Together, they can make a fabric that's both functional and comfortable.
